An OrganWise Breakfast for Your Kids

We loved the idea of making Valentine’s Day special by making a FUN and healthy breakfast for the whole family. Last weekend, one of our very own OrganWise families tried out this idea. As you can see, it was an easy way for kids to be involved in the process. They made heart-shaped, whole wheat pancakes with apple sauce instead of oil, eggs (egg whites can also be used) and low-fat milk. We let the kids be involved in the prep, (clean up!) and design of their pancakes.

Engaging little ones in the creation of meals inspires them to try new foods while learning important life skills such as reading, following directions, measuring, calculating and more. But most of all, they will remember the connection of quality time spent together. What better way to celebrate “Heart” day than that!
